Operation as gatekeeper’s intercom PSS09 

Introduction 

The FWG09 can send its messages not only to a call center but also to a normal telephone. This 
operating mode is called the gatekeeper’s intercom PSS09. 

The gatekeeper's intercom is a complete lift emergency call system and also behaves accordingly. 
This means that messages must be accepted, understood and acknowledged. 

If the acknowledgement is not received, the emergency call system will continue to call continuously.  
This happens automatically regardless of time or telephone costs. 

All further messages, such as periodic calls of the unit and technical messages must be accepted and 
processed with due care. 

Acceptance of emergency calls should only be made by appropriately trained employees. For this 
purpose, it is possible to assign a PIN. 

For easier identification in the case of several emergency call systems, a predefined text can be 
announced instead of the object number. This carries an extra cost. For more information, please 
contact base engineering gmbh. 

The requirements with which lift operators are to comply are outlined in EN81-28. 

The software variant 1 complies with EN81-28. Variants 2, 2A, 3, 3A and 3B are not compliant with 
EN81-28 and are thus to be set at one’s own responsibility. 

Technical requirements 

When choosing, no evaluation is made on the dialing tone or the like. The device dials the 
programmed telephone numbers in blind dialing mode. A pause of 2 seconds is inserted for the 
outside line if “0” and “9” are the first digits. This pause can also be turned off by setting the menu 
item “

Trunk line seizure…

” to “

blind dial

”. 

If the PSS09 is used in conjunction with a GSM13 the PSS09 must be configured for “

blind dial

”.  

The following technical parameters are supported: 

The dialing mode should be MFV with analog DTMF level. We recommend the setting “variable 
dialing mode” for PABX. 

Call sign detection, 25 or 50Hz: 1000ms on, 4000ms off or 300ms on, 400ms off, 300ms on, 4000ms 
off.
